Hello ,

I recently has a Astrostart RS-5224 remote start installed on my 2005 Dodge Ram 3500. I lost the feature of when you press unlock doors on the factory key fob the cargo light in the bed would also turn on. With my Astrostart key fob when I press unlock the cargo light does not come on. Does anyone know how to make this work ?

I like having my cargo light on when I unlock the doors.

Send a positive 1 sec signal thru a 120ohm resisttor to the lt grn/dk grn (driver) , lt grn/wht (passenger) which are located behind the switch. Pulse again to turn off. This will turn the seats onto the high position.

As for losing the cargo light, I wasn't aware that anything should change when unlocking with the rs remote.
